Franklin D. Roosevelt: 1882-1945

FRANKLIN D. ROOSEVELT LIBRARY

Born to considerable wealth, Franklin Delano Roosevelt, pictured here at age 12 with his mother, Sara, led a cloistered existence as an only child on his family's Hudson River valley estate in Hyde Park, N. Y. The autocratic Sara Roosevelt played a leading role throughout her son's life and political career, prompting Eleanor Roosevelt to observe that she seemed to want "to direct his every thought and deed."
